Tim Walker writes novels for children and young adults, and has run workshops for private, public and voluntary organisations. He turned to writing fiction after a long career in design, during which he wrote for Creative Review, PR Week and Design Magazine, and edited copy for the National Trust, Macmillan Cancer Relief, the Royal Society, Ernst and Young, the Child Support Agency and others. Tim has worked as a visiting author in schools. He was RLF Writing Fellow at the University of Kent, where he continues to work mentoring students and leading workshops on academic writing skills. He is the author of the Fizzle stories – Shipley Manor, The Flying Fizzler and Rise Of The Rattler – and is currently working on his second trilogy.
